You can get grobags up until at least 36 months and sometimes up until 5 years if I am not mistaken? I have 2 for dd which go up to 36 months so can get another year out of them hopefully. The other thing is if you know someone enterprising enough you can get them made and probably for less than you buy them. Mine are .5 togs as they are what I use most of the year but got a 1 tog ( more or less) made by my friend when she went on vacation this year, looks great and cost me about 15 euro .
